Can you recommend bands similar to these, specifically Mortifera? I really enjoyed that song.

First of all check out the rest of that album, the whole thing is comperable to that first song. It's hard to say who Mortifera sounds like exactly. A lot of the riff patterns remind me of Mutiilation, expect pretty. Perhaps Nyktalgia have a similar blend of rawness and melancholia, though Nyktalgia can be prone to Burzum worship.
